Politicians appear in denial on climate change

WASHINGTON – If a politician were told that, after lengthy study and analysis, more than 97 percent of political observers concluded that that politician was going to lose, do you think such a warning would spur a campaign to immediate action?

Of course. Unless the politician was delusional.

Well, consider this: Precisely that overwhelming percentage of scientists involved in climate research have concluded that there has been “unequivocal” warming of the Earth’s average global temperature in recent decades and that human-generated greenhouse gases are mostly responsible.

But while it is evident that the science of climate change, also known as global warming, is convincing and conclusive, it is not an exaggeration to say that the politics of an issue that will determine the fate of the planet is quite unsettled.

Last week, the Obama administration released a landmark, 800-page climate assessment report that essentially told the public that climate change is a threat and is affecting every part of the nation (and, of course, the rest of the globe). The sea levels are rising, floods and storm surges are more severe, rains are more intense in the Northeast, droughts and wildfires more pronounced in the West. The changes are affecting or will affect, among other things, where we live and work, how healthy we are, what we grow and what we eat and what other species will thrive or perish, including us.
